1 条题解
-
0
C :
#include<stdio.h> void main() { int r1,r2; double s,p=3.14; scanf("%d%d",&r1,&r2); s=p*r1*r1-p*r2*r2; printf("%.2f",s); }C++ :
#include<bits/stdc++.h> using namespace std; int main(){ int r1,r2; double s,pi = 3.14; cin>>r1>>r2; s = pi * r1 * r1 - pi * r2 * r2; cout<<fixed<<setprecision(2)<<s<<endl; return 0; }Pascal :
var i,j,n,m:integer; begin read(n,m); writeln((n*n-m*m)*3.14:0:2); end.Java :
import java.util.Scanner; public class Main { public static void main(String[] args) { Scanner sc = new Scanner(System.in); int r1 = sc.nextInt(); int r2 = sc.nextInt(); double pi = 3.14; double s1,s2,s3; s1 = pi * r1 * r1; s2 = pi * r2 * r2; s3 = s1 - s2; System.out.printf("%.2f",s3); } }Python :
a,b=map(int,input().split()) s=a*a*3.14-b*b*3.14 print('{:.2f}'.format(s))
- 1
信息
- ID
- 318
- 时间
- 1000ms
- 内存
- 256MiB
- 难度
- 10
- 标签
- 递交数
- 2
- 已通过
- 1
- 上传者